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Inc. vs Heron Therapeutics Inc — how do they compare? 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Inc. trades at $29.55 (market cap $5.07B), while Heron Therapeutics Inc trades at $0.34 (market cap $61.47M). The key difference: 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Inc. is far larger — about 82.5× Heron Therapeutics Inc's market cap, and 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Inc. is trading nearer its 52-week high, Heron Therapeutics Inc nearer its low. 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Inc.

ACADIA Pharmaceuticals (ACAD) trades at $29.70, up 1.05% today, with a bullish technical trend and strong analyst support. The company reported robust Q2 2026 earnings, beating estimates with $0.18 EPS, and raised its 2026 revenue outlook. Revenue grew to $1.07 billion in 2025, with net income surging to $391 million, reflecting a 36.49% margin. Recent FDA Fast Track designation for remlifanserin in Alzheimer's disease psychosis adds to positive catalysts.

The outlook remains positive given earnings momentum and product sales growth, though high valuation multiples and recent negative cash flow pose risks. Analyst consensus targets $33.89, implying ~14% upside, with 70% recommending Buy. Key risks include clinical trial outcomes and competitive pressures in the biopharma sector.

Heron Therapeutics Inc

HRTX trades at $0.3507, up 6.21% in the last 24 hours, but technical indicators signal a bearish trend overall. The company reported Q2 2026 revenue of $37.7 million, missing estimates, with a net loss per share of $0.03. Despite a high gross profit margin of 70.07%, negative net income and cash flow from operations highlight financial strain. Analyst consensus remains strongly bullish with 94.74% buy ratings, but recent news includes a Zacks Strong Sell designation on July 15, 2026.

The outlook is mixed: strong analyst support contrasts with weak earnings and bearish technicals. Investment opportunity lies in potential turnaround if revenue growth accelerates, but risks include persistent losses, competitive pressures, and reliance on financing activities. The stock faces significant downside if operational performance does not improve.

About ACADIA Pharmaceuticals Inc.

Acadia Pharmaceuticals is a biotechnology company that develops and commercializes biopharmaceutical products to address central nervous system disorders. The company aims to discover small molecule drugs that address disorders such as Parkinson's, Alzheimer's, and schizophrenia. Acadia also seeks to in-license or acquire complementary products and candidates. The company's patent applications claim proprietary technology, including novel methods of screening and chemical synthetic methods, novel drug targets, and novel compounds identified using its technology.

About Heron Therapeutics Inc

Heron Therapeutics is a commercial-stage biotechnology company focused on improving patient care. It develops best-in-class medicines for pain management and cancer care to address unmet medical needs.
